Overview of Grip Materials: Cork vs. EVA Foam
When we think about trekking pole grips, it’s essential to understand the differences between cork and EVA foam. Here’s a quick comparison:
- Cork Grip:
- Natural, eco-friendly material
- Excellent moisture-wicking properties
- Molds to our hand over time for comfort
- Superior grip in wet conditions
- Heavier than EVA foam
- EVA Foam:
- Synthetic and lighter than cork
- Exceptionally durable and resistant to wear
- Water-resistant, preventing moisture absorption
- Offers good shock absorption
- Versatile across various climates
Both materials have their pros and cons. Choosing between cork grip and EVA foam often comes down to personal preference and specific hiking needs. The Importance of Ergonomic Design

Ergonomic design in trekking poles isn’t just a trendy feature; it’s essential for enhancing our hiking experience. Here’s why we should prioritize ergonomic benefits for better hiking performance:
- Improved Posture: Ergonomic grips promote an upright position, reducing neck and back strain.
- Joint Stress Relief: They redistribute weight from our legs to our upper body, easing knee and hip stress.
- Increased Stability: Better grips enhance our control on uneven terrain, boosting our confidence.
- Enhanced Comfort: Comfortably molded grips reduce pressure, allowing longer use.
- Energy Conservation: Good grip design helps maintain our posture, optimizing lung capacity and reducing fatigue.

Durability Factors: Cork and EVA Foam

Selecting the right grip material for our trekking poles impacts not only comfort but also durability. Here’s a quick comparison:
Cork Durability:
- Cork wicks moisture, keeping hands dry.
- Less durable with heavy use, may deteriorate over time.
- Molds to our hands, enhancing sensitivity.
EVA Longevity:
- EVA foam is water-resistant and ideal for wet conditions.
- More durable, can withstand rigorous use without wear.
- Offers cushioning, reducing hand fatigue.

Advantages of EVA Foam Grips
While sustainability is a key aspect of grip material selection, the advantages of EVA foam grips cannot be overlooked. Let’s explore some of the key benefits:
- EVA Durability: These grips resist breaking down over time, maintaining their integrity even in wet conditions. They compress less than other materials, ensuring consistent performance.
- EVA Comfort: With a soft, cushioned surface, EVA grips reduce hand fatigue on long hikes. They absorb shock efficiently, lessening wrist strain.
- Weather Resistance: Their water-resistant nature means they won’t swell or degrade with moisture, keeping them reliable.
- Lightweight and Cost-Effective: EVA grips are budget-friendly and keep trekking poles light, perfect for long-distance hikes.

Benefits of Cork Grips
Cork grips are an excellent choice for trekkers seeking both comfort and functionality in their poles. Here are the key benefits we appreciate about cork grips:
- Moisture Management: Cork effectively wicks away cork grip moisture, keeping our hands dry in humid conditions.
- Personalized Comfort: Over time, cork molds to the shape of our hands, providing personalized cork comfort that enhanced our experience.
- Shock Absorption: The soft nature of cork reduces vibrations, making long hikes more comfortable.
- Secure Grip: Even when wet, cork maintains a strong grip, minimizing the risk of slipping.
- Eco-Friendly: As a natural material, cork is biodegradable and sustainable, aligning with our values for environmental responsibility.

Ergonomics of Wrist Straps in Trekking Poles
A strong grip isn’t just about the material; it’s also about how we hold our trekking poles, particularly through the use of wrist straps. Ergonomic wrist straps play an important role in our hiking experience. Here’s what we should consider:
- Adjustable Straps: They accommodate different hand sizes, enhancing comfort.
- Weight Distribution: Straps help evenly distribute weight, reducing strain on our hands and wrists.
- Customization: We can modify straps for preferred lengths, even swapping materials for lighter options.
- Quick-Release Mechanisms: They allow for easy adjustments based on terrain or personal preference.
Using wrist straps helps maintain proper posture and reduces fatigue, making them an essential feature for our trekking adventures. How Do I Choose the Right Grip Size?
To choose the right grip size, we should measure our hand circumference and consider comfort. A grip diameter of 1 inch to 1⅜ inches often provides ideal comfort, minimizing fatigue during our outdoor adventures.
